Output ddc0efbe91db04134ac1406ed17ef66b91812e2b809c34cf94df738ea98a4f93:28

value
251120
script pubkey
OP_0 OP_PUSHBYTES_20 56dce16ec98cb952384f32dfc61263f9300388d7
address
bc1q2mwwzmkf3ju4ywz0xt0uvynrlycq8zxhryp5m3
transaction
ddc0efbe91db04134ac1406ed17ef66b91812e2b809c34cf94df738ea98a4f93
spent
true